The Galdhrim are a faction begun the 22 of November, 2015. They were founded by Cookminers, who wished to begin a faction among the eaves of the maple, beech, and birch trees of Chetwood.

Heritage

The heritage of the Galdhrim is somewhat of a muddy area, the Elves coming from every group. Sindar, Noldor, Teler, Nando, they are all welcome in the Woods of the Sun.

Cities

Eryn Anór - Located at and around the Archet FT(Fast Travel) point, Eryn Anór is small but growing. The many-pillared homes there already attract a few tourists who wish to see the open-aired homes of maple and Galadhrim brick, and some wish to emulate them and so come to study their construction. They look very similar to the High Elven buildings some build, but they have a unique flair to them.
